diff --git a/package/gluon-ebtables-limit-arp/src/gluon-arp-limiter.c b/package/gluon-ebtables-limit-arp/src/gluon-arp-limiter.c index 9c764006..c14fce6b 100644 --- a/package/gluon-ebtables-limit-arp/src/gluon-arp-limiter.c +++ b/package/gluon-ebtables-limit-arp/src/gluon-arp-limiter.c @@ -25,6 +25,8 @@ static struct addr_store ip_store; static struct addr_store mac_store; +int clock; + char *addr_mac_ntoa(void *addr) { return mac_ntoa((struct mac_addr *)addr); diff --git a/package/gluon-ebtables-limit-arp/src/gluon-arp-limiter.h b/package/gluon-ebtables-limit-arp/src/gluon-arp-limiter.h index 203ab217..3715ed70 100644 --- a/package/gluon-ebtables-limit-arp/src/gluon-arp-limiter.h +++ b/package/gluon-ebtables-limit-arp/src/gluon-arp-limiter.h @@ -8,6 +8,6 @@ #ifndef _GLUON_ARP_LIMITER_H_ #define _GLUON_ARP_LIMITER_H_ -int clock; +extern int clock; #endif /* _GLUON_ARP_LIMITER_H_ */